Katharina Poehlmann

Vice President, Head of Strategy at A.P. Moller - Maersk

Professional Background

Katharina Poehlmann is a distinguished leader in the logistics and supply chain management sector, boasting a rich career marked by substantial achievements and significant leadership roles. Currently, she serves as the Vice President and Head of Strategy at A.P. Moller - Maersk, a globally recognized company in the shipping and logistics industry. In her capacity, Katharina plays a critical role in steering strategic initiatives that aim to optimize the company's operations and enhance its market positioning.

Before ascending to her current role, Katharina held the prestigious position of Global Head of Cold Chain Logistics at A.P. Moller - Maersk. In this critical role, she was responsible for overseeing the comprehensive cold chain logistics operations, ensuring that temperature-sensitive products were transported effectively and efficiently across the globe. Her leadership and strategic insights were pivotal in enhancing the company's capabilities in this vital sector of logistics, which is increasingly crucial in today's economy, particularly in the context of global trade and the growing demand for perishable goods.

Prior to her impactful tenure at A.P. Moller - Maersk, Katharina made significant contributions as the Head of the CEO Office at the same organization. This role allowed her to closely collaborate with senior leadership and gain invaluable insights into high-level decision-making processes within a large multinational corporation. Her diverse experiences within the company have equipped her with a holistic understanding of the logistics industry and honed her strategic thinking and leadership skills.

Katharina's career also includes notable positions at leading global consulting firms. She previously served as Associate Principal at McKinsey & Company, where she provided strategic guidance to a variety of clients, helping them navigate complex business challenges. Additionally, her role as Project Leader at The Boston Consulting Group further solidified her expertise in strategic management and consulting, allowing her to develop innovative solutions tailored for diverse industries.

Education and Achievements

Katharina's professional journey is underpinned by a strong educational foundation. She studied Business Administration and Mechanical Engineering at the prestigious Technical University of Munich, one of Germany’s top universities known for its rigorous academic programs and emphasis on innovation and research. Her dual focus on business administration and engineering has provided her with a unique skill set that blends strategic business insights with technical acumen, enabling her to thrive at the intersection of these fields.
